Abstract

The utility model relates to a groundwater pollution remediation technology, and in particular relates to an aeration and iron-carbon micro-electrolysis combined treatment device of organic polluted groundwater. The combined treatment device comprises a pipeline system, a water inlet pump, a water outlet pump and a groundwater treatment device, wherein the pipeline system is divided into a pipeline system I and a pipeline system II; the pipeline system I is communicated with the water outlet pump, and the pipeline system II is communicated with the water inlet pump; the water inlet pump and the water outlet pump are communicated with the groundwater treatment device respectively. By adopting the technical scheme, the aeration and iron-carbon micro-electrolysis combined treatment device disclosed by the utility model has the beneficial effects that the combined treatment device has a relatively good removal effect on organic pollutants which are difficult to degrade; compared with other remediation technologies for treating the organic polluted groundwater, the combined treatment device has the characteristics of low cost, no secondary pollution and good treatment effect.

Embodiment
For detailed explanation the technical solution of the utility model, below by embodiment, the utility model is further explained.
As shown in Figure 1, this device is divided into three, groundwater treatment part, underground water transport portion and tubing system part, three connects by pipeline, tubing system is divided into tubing system 1 and tubing system 2 10, tubing system 1 with go out water pump 3 and be connected, tubing system two is connected with intake pump 4, go out water pump 3 and be connected with groundwater treatment system by pipeline respectively with intake pump 4, underground water is processed.Going out water pump 3 extracts underground water to send into treatment system out, process underground water later from treatment system and pass through again intake pump 4, by tubing system 2 10, underground water after treatment is sent into underground, so circulation, underground water is carried out to continuous pollution processing, relatively simple for structure, and continuous treating processes effectively prevents secondary pollution, and scrubbing effect is better.Treatment system comprises that pH regulator pond 2 and micro-electrolysis reaction still 1 form, going out water pump 3 is connected by pipeline with pH regulator pond 2, underground water is sent in pH regulator pond 2, sent in micro-electrolysis reaction still 1 by extraction pump 6 from pH regulator pond 2 underground water out, reactor 1 underground water after treatment is discharged and is sent in tubing system 2 10 and then enter undergroundly by intake pump 4 again, completes whole circulation.Wherein desilting mouth 7 is arranged at reactor 1 bottom, and gas blower 8, and the sewage in micro-electrolysis reaction still 1 is blasted to air, improves organic evaporation rate.First the contaminated underground water extracting is processed through pH regulator pond 2, process entering in micro-electrolysis reaction still 1 subsequently, finally enter underground by intake pump 4 again, whole process is comparatively reasonable, specific aim and the order processed are stronger, scrubbing process can not be interrupted continuously, and micro-electrolysis reaction still 1 bottom arrange desilting mouth 7 and gas blower 8 pollutent is for further processing, prevent secondary pollution.
Further, as shown in Figure 1, between micro-electrolysis reaction still 1 and pH regulator pond 2, be provided with real time monitoring apparatus 5, two treating processess are monitored in real time, maneuvering ability is better, can after going wrong, feed back in time, has ensured the stability of whole device scrubbing process.
Further, as shown in Figure 2, tubing system 1 and tubing system 2 10 are made up of a house steward and multiple arm 11 respectively, and multiple arms 11 are all connected with house steward, are evenly distributed on house steward.In the process that groundwater abstraction and underground water are sent into, multiple equally distributed arms 11 can extract and send into the contaminated underground water of nearly all position of underground water, in whole process, effectively prevent that scrubbing blind area from appearring in underground water, there will not be the underground water in partial area to can not get polluting processing, improved the comprehensive of organic contamination processing, processing efficiency is higher.
